Introduction

When it comes to construction and scaffolding, having the right tools is essential for efficiency and safety. A scaffold hammer is a must-have for any builder or contractor. This tool is specifically designed for tasks related to scaffolding, making it ideal for both professional and DIY projects. The scaffold hammer combines a traditional hammer's striking power with features that cater to the unique needs of scaffold assembly and disassembly.

Here are some key aspects of scaffold hammers:
  • Durability: Scaffold hammers are made from high-quality materials, ensuring they can withstand the rigors of construction work.
  • Ergonomic Design: Many models feature comfortable grips and balanced weights, reducing user fatigue during long hours of work.
  • Versatility: With a flat striking face and a claw, these hammers can drive nails and remove them with ease.

FAQs

How can I choose the best scaffold hammer for my needs?

Look for a scaffold hammer that is durable, lightweight, and has an ergonomic grip. Consider the weight that feels comfortable for you and check if it has a claw for nail removal.

What are the key features to look for when selecting a scaffold hammer?

Key features include a sturdy construction, a comfortable handle, a flat striking face, and a claw for pulling nails. These features enhance usability and efficiency.

Are there any common mistakes people make when purchasing a scaffold hammer?

Common mistakes include choosing a hammer that is too heavy, neglecting the importance of a comfortable grip, or opting for a low-quality material that may not withstand heavy use.

Can a scaffold hammer be used for other types of construction work?

Yes, while designed for scaffolding, a scaffold hammer can also be used for general framing and other construction tasks due to its versatility.
